36 U.S.C. § 112 — Honor America Days

(a) Designation.—The 21 days from Flag Day through Independence Day is a period to honor America. (b) Congressional Declaration.—Congress declares that there be public gatherings and activities during that period at which the people of the United States can celebrate and honor their country in an appropriate way.
